Hemivertebra resection is a surgical procedure aimed at correcting spinal deformities caused by the presence of a hemivertebra, which is an incomplete or malformed vertebra resulting from abnormal development during embryonic growth. This congenital condition can lead to varying degrees of scoliosis or kyphosis, as the asymmetrical development of the vertebra can disrupt the normal alignment and curvature of the spine. The causes of hemivertebra formation are primarily genetic and developmental, with associated factors possibly including environmental influences during pregnancy. Symptoms associated with hemivertebra include noticeable spinal curvature, uneven shoulders or hips, pain in the back or neck, limited range of motion, and neurological deficits in severe cases due to nerve compression. Patients may experience discomfort or fatigue, particularly during physical activities, and in some instances, the deformity may result in significant cosmetic concerns that can affect self-esteem and quality of life. Early diagnosis is crucial, often made through physical examinations, X-rays, or MRI scans to assess the structure and function of the spine. Treatment options can vary based on the severity of the condition and the age of the patient, but hemivertebra resection is often recommended for those with progressive deformities or significant symptoms. During the procedure, the surgeon removes the hemivertebra through an incision, typically along the back, to restore normal alignment and spinal function. The resection may be accompanied by spinal fusion to stabilize the area, ensuring that the remaining vertebrae heal and support the spine correctly. Postoperatively, patients may require rehabilitation, including physical therapy, to regain strength and mobility, as well as to prevent complications such as infection or blood clots. The success of hemivertebra resection can greatly improve the patient's quality of life, alleviating pain, restoring spinal balance, and enhancing overall physical function, although risks exist as with any surgical intervention. Long-term follow-up is often necessary to monitor the spine's development and function as the patient grows or ages, ensuring that further intervention is made if needed. Overall, hemivertebra resection serves as a vital corrective measure for individuals affected by this condition, offering hope for improved spinal alignment and a healthier lifestyle.
